What does the San Antonio River Authority do?
Funded by property taxes, the River Authority upholds a commitment to “providing safe, clean and enjoyable creeks and rivers,” which in its 83 years has led to a multitude of partnerships, research initiatives, and projects that integrate public health with ecosystems and sustainability with economic development.
